3 Power jurisdiction will continue with power outages in 12,200 units (5am on the 16th) 5:26 on October 16th

Under the influence of Typhoon No. 19 and others, power outages continue in Tokyo Electric Power Company, Chubu Electric Power Company and Tohoku Electric Power Co., Ltd. at around 5 am, with a total of 12,200 units.

TEPCO jurisdiction

In the Kanto region, Yamanashi prefecture, and Shizuoka prefecture within the TEPCO jurisdiction, power outages continue in about 5400 units.

Out of these, 2200 units in Chiba Prefecture and 1200 units in Kanagawa Prefecture, where a large-scale power outage lasted for a long time due to Typhoon No. 15 last month, had a power outage.

Inside Chubu Electric Power

On the other hand, in Nagano Prefecture, which is in the Chubu Electric Power region, power outages continue at 6,500 units. By municipality, there are 3410 units in Nagano City, 1350 units in Karuizawa Town, and 670 units in Saku City.

Tohoku Electric Power jurisdiction

In addition, a total of 340 units have been out of power in Miyagi and Fukushima prefectures within Tohoku Electric Power. Out of these, power outages continue in Miyagi Prefecture, including a total of 300 units in Marumori Town and 40 units in Fukushima Prefecture.

According to each power company, in areas where flooding or landslides have occurred due to river flooding, etc., there are places where restoration work has not begun, and it may take some time before restoration.

Electricity companies call for not using electrical appliances that have been submerged in water in addition to turning off the circuit breaker, as there is a risk of electrical leakage if the building is submerged.
